NASA announces discovery of a second Earth

Have we finally found another planet like our own - an Earth 2.0 ? Astronomers using the Kepler Telescope have found the most Earth-like extrasolar planet ever discovered. Kepler-452b is thought to

Strange alien like animal found on Mars!

The latest NASA pictures from the Mars Rover have captured a shot of a strange alien like animal on the surface of Mars. Over the last year, the Rover has been

The next Bermuda Triangle? Malaysian oil tanker goes missing in South China Sea

A Malaysian oil tanker carrying $5.5 million worth of fuel has gone missing in the South China Sea.   A Malaysian oil tanker has gone missing in the South China Sea,